Does Montana require an inspection for vehicle registration?
Safety Inspection for MT Car Registration Unlike many other states, Montana does not require a safety inspection for vehicle registration or for registration renewal. The responsibility for maintaining a safe operating vehicle – replacing cracked windshields, changing brake pads, fixing broken headlamps, brake lights and directionals – falls upon you. Emissions Inspection for Smog The MVD does not require a smog check (emissions testing) for vehicle registration. Register Car in Montana To apply for vehicle registration, visit your local MVD office (in most areas this will be your county treasurer) and provide: A properly assigned car title. A completed Application for Certificate of Title for a Motor Vehicle. This can be downloaded from the MVD's website. A bill of..

Do scooters and mopeds require vehicle registration?
Classifying and Registering Mopeds and Scooters With motorcycles, it’s pretty easy. You register your bike and take off on your merry motorcycle riding way. However, car registration for mopeds and scooters is an extremely gray issue. If you're the owner of a scooter or a moped, check with at least two different DMV agents in your state for how to register your bike. Even DMV agents have difficulty pinpointing whether a moped or scooter requires motorcycle registration, vehicle registration or registration at all. When it comes to classifying bikes as scooters, mopeds, or even motorcycles, engine size is often the determining factor. To further cloudy the situation, some states have different scooter categories with different registration requirements. Note, though, that if..

What are the MT emissions or smog check requirements for vehicle registration?
Montana Emissions Inspection for Car Registration There is no required smog check (emissions testing) in Montana. Given the state's rural personality and relatively small urban centers - Billings, Montana's largest city, has less than 100,000 residents – smog is not a major environmental issue. Nor, for vehicle registration, do you have to provide proof of passing an annual safety inspection. Maintaining your vehicle is your responsibility. Register Car in MT The lack of required inspections and testing makes applying for car registration in Montana a simple process. To apply, visit your local MVD office (in most scenarios this will be your county treasurer) and provide: A properly assigned title. A bill of sale. A completed Application for..
